Смарт Лид Солюшенз

Team Lead / Full-stack Developer

Не указана
  • Минск
  • Полная занятость
  • Полный день
  • От 3 до 6 лет

We are looking for a hands-on Team Lead to lead an engineering team building a data management platform with complex integrations, real-time processing, and multi-tenant architecture. The role combines technical leadership, delivery ownership, and active development, with a strong focus on modern AI-assisted engineering practices.​

Key responsibilities

  • Lead delivery: planning, task breakdown, estimations, quality, and releases

  • Technical leadership across React/Node.js/TypeScript

  • Own architecture decisions (multi-tenant, RBAC, reliability, security)

  • Drive team standards: code reviews, testing strategy, performance practices

  • Champion AI-assisted development (team-wide best practices, faster prototyping, productivity)

Requirements

  • 5+ years in full-stack development; 1–2+ years leading/mentoring engineers

  • Strong React + TypeScript (complex UI/dashboards)

  • Strong Node.js + TypeScript, REST APIs, real-time data flows

  • PostgreSQL/Supabase experience (data modeling, optimization)

  • Confident use of AI tools in development (and ability to scale usage across the team)

  • Professional level of Russian + English (B2+) (written and spoken)​

Nice to have:

DevOps ownership: experience owning delivery operations - setting up and maintaining CI/CD pipelines and release processes, collaborating on Docker/Kubernetes deployment standards, and promoting DevOps best practices across the team

What we offer

  • Office-based position in Minsk

  • Working with a collaborative team on a challenging, high-impact products

  • Opportunity to shape engineering culture and development processes, including an AI-first approach to delivery

  • Professional growth in modern full-stack development, architecture, and leadership